Description

The Eveready 15W oven bulb is a heat-resistant incandescent lamp rated to 300°C, designed for cookers, ovens and other high-temperature appliances. The bulb uses an E14 (small Edison screw) base and produces 100 lumens of warm white light at 2800K, allowing you to monitor food through the oven door without opening it and losing heat.

Fitted inside ovens, cookers and warming cabinets, the bulb's reinforced glass envelope withstands sustained high temperatures during baking, roasting and grilling cycles. The 15W power draw is typical for oven lamps and provides enough light to see through tinted or partially obscured oven glass. The non-dimmable design means the bulb operates at full brightness whenever the oven light switch is activated.

The E14 base is the standard small Edison screw fitting used in most UK and European ovens, making the bulb a direct replacement for factory-installed oven lamps. The compact bulb dimensions allow it to fit within the protective glass cover housings found in oven cavities. Eveready rates the bulb for use up to 300°C, covering standard domestic oven operating temperatures (typically 180-250°C) with headroom for cleaning cycles and higher-heat commercial use.

Frequently Asked

Will this bulb fit my oven?

The bulb uses an E14 (small Edison screw) base, which is the standard fitting in most UK and European domestic ovens. Check your existing oven bulb's base type before ordering — if it has a small screw base approximately 14mm in diameter, this bulb will fit.

Can it handle self-cleaning oven cycles?

The bulb is rated to 300°C continuous operation. Most domestic self-cleaning cycles run at 480-500°C, which exceeds the bulb's rating. Turn off the oven light during self-cleaning cycles or consult your oven manual to confirm whether the lamp housing is insulated from the cleaning cycle temperature.

Why is it incandescent rather than LED?

Most LED bulbs cannot operate reliably above 60-80°C due to driver electronics overheating. Incandescent bulbs have no electronics and their filament design tolerates sustained high temperatures, making them the appropriate technology for oven lamps.

How long does it last?

Incandescent oven bulbs typically last 1,000-2,000 hours under normal use. In ovens the bulb is only switched on when you need to check food progress, so actual runtime is low compared to room lighting, often giving several years of service before replacement is needed.
